RF
coat-insulated fusing resistor
EU
features
• Functions as a resistor in normal condition
• Quick fusing protects circuit from excessive
overload at an abnormal time
• Flame-retardant coating equivalent to UL94 V-0
• Marking: Blue body color with color code marking
• Products meet EU RoHS requirements

Rated Ambient Temperature: +70°C
Operating Temperature Range: −40 – +155°C
Rated voltage = √Power Rating×Resistance value

Derating Curve
100
For resistors operated at an ambient temperature of 70°C or above, a power
rating shall be derated in accordance with derating curve on the left.
